While modern vehicle safety systems are highly sophisticated, a rare yet potentially costly issue can arise from unexpected airbag deployments. These incidents, though infrequent, can be triggered by a variety of factors beyond severe collisions, including particularly rough road conditions, significant impacts from potholes, or even sensor malfunctions that mistakenly interpret everyday bumps or vibrations as a signal to deploy. When an airbag deploys, it's not just about the immediate safety benefit; the aftermath often involves substantial financial repercussions for the vehicle owner. The intricate nature of airbag systems means that a deployment necessitates the replacement of not only the airbag modules themselves but also associated sensors, control units, and potentially even parts of the vehicle's interior trim that were damaged during the deployment. This can quickly escalate repair bills into the thousands of dollars, even if the underlying cause was a minor road imperfection rather than a serious accident. Drivers who experience an unintended airbag deployment often find themselves facing a perplexing situation. The system is designed to activate only under specific, high-impact conditions, making a deployment due to routine driving a cause for concern. Investigations into such occurrences often focus on the sensitivity of the impact sensors, which are calibrated to detect rapid deceleration. However, external factors can sometimes interfere with this calibration or trigger a false positive. For instance, hitting a severe pothole at speed, driving over uneven or severely damaged road surfaces for an extended period, or even a strong jolt from an undercarriage impact could theoretically be misinterpreted by the system. Beyond physical road conditions, electronic interference or internal glitches within the airbag control module are also possibilities, albeit rarer ones. The lack of a major collision makes it difficult for owners to justify such an expense, leading to frustration and often a deep dive into the specifics of their vehicle's warranty and the circumstances surrounding the deployment. The financial burden associated with an unexpected airbag deployment cannot be understated. Repairing a deployed airbag system involves a comprehensive replacement and recalibration process. This includes new airbags for the affected areas (steering wheel, dashboard, seats, etc.), which are sophisticated pyrotechnic devices. Critically, the airbag control module, the brain of the system, often needs to be replaced or reprogrammed if it has registered the deployment event. Sensors throughout the vehicle that detect impact and trigger the airbags also require inspection and likely replacement. Furthermore, the interior components that house the airbags, such as dashboard panels and steering wheel covers, are designed to rupture or open during deployment and will need to be replaced. The labor costs for diagnosing the issue, replacing the numerous components, and then recalibrating the entire system to ensure it functions correctly for future potential incidents can be substantial.
